??? Here's the story ...
??? I migrated to Canada from England in 1968 to join the Chief Accountants Department of TD Bank. In 1969, the bank embarked on implementing Management by Objectives (MBO) across its system.
??? The idea of MBO was first outlined by Peter Drucker in his book “The Practice of Management” (1954). MBO was then developed by George Odiorne, his student, and became popular in the 1960s and 1970s.
??? To help us become aware about MBO, everyone from the Chairman of the Board to first-line supervisors (such as myself) had to attend a 4-day seminar on MBO. The seminar leaders were a university professor and a management consultant.
??? On the first day, the consultant pronounced that “Only the Future is Manageable” which he explained as follows.
~ You can’t manage the Past, because it is over. You can only change a previous decision by making a new decision, sometime from now.
~ You can’t manage the Present, because it doesn’t exist. It is a fleeting nano-second of time as we move from the Past into the Future.

??? Therefore, management is about “managing what hasn’t happened yet.” ... Let that sink in! ... You need to anticipate the future and ensure every decision you make will be as effective as possible for the future. And this is where MBO comes in.
??? Back then, MBO was also called Corporate Planning, but today it is Strategic Planning. In order to plan and set objectives, you need to anticipate future change and figure out how various trends are going to manifest themselves in various scenarios.
